[QUOTE="CU44SE, post: 4583956, member: 2196"] I think there are 2 aspects to this. On one hand, I look at it similar to football. If you are a QB and offensive coordinator. Do you want to go against the same defense every single play? Do you think you may be able to make some adjustments if the team runs the same defense the entire game? I think there is a place in the game for zone defense. I just don’t think you should only play zone defense. I also think the biggest issue with our zone defenses recently was the lack of athleticism on the floor. look back at the past 10 years. We have continuously been missing long athletic players that we used to always have. How many times did we play Marek out of position down low? How many times are we going to watch girard, cooney, buddy, even tyus not get out on shooters or not close off the lane from penetration? Not to mention all the new guys and transfers that have come in and only played 1 or 2 seasons. We are not getting anyone to stay and learn the defense. Braswell is the best wing defender I have seen in the past several years and Jim refused to play him until it was too late (injuries as well). We don’t have the prototypical athletes that we used to have. When Syracuse used to play zone, it was not your Rec league zone. It was tall, long, athletic dudes closing everything off. Now Jim has sacrificed that for offense and shooters. And the zone has now turned into that rec league zone. Where we have smaller, slower guys that can shoot but don’t get after it on the defensive side of the ball. This isn’t the zone that Syracuse predicated itself on. [/QUOTE]
